Nancy climbed a tree. --->


Nancy quickly climbed the 20-foot tree like a monkey searching for a banana.

Nancy quickly climbed the 20-foot tree like a monkey searching for a banana.

1. Quickly - Added adverb. 

2. 20-foot - Added adjective. 

3. Like a monkey searching for a banana - Added simile.

I saw the mouse run across the table. -->

I shrieked when I saw the tiny mouse dart across the kitchen table! 

I shrieked when I saw the tiny mouse dart across the kitchen table! 

1. Shrieked - Added verb. 

2. Tiny - Added adjective. 

3. Dart - Changed verb. 

4. Kitchen - Added adjective.
